To support us on our journey, Sinai Health System is looking for a Diet Technician to support Nutrition, Milk Bank Department at our Mount Sinai Hospital Campus.

The Diet Technician will perform all duties necessary to ensure the highest standard of handling, pasteurization, and storage of human donor milk following approved Milk Bank SOP’s and guidelines from MSH Infection Control, Public Health Food Manufacturing Standards and the Human Milk Banking Association of North America (HMBANA).

Responsibilities:
Accurately weigh, measure and prepare batches for pasteurization
Prepare labels to identify mother’s milk for each deposits and document in Timeless Milk Tracking System the number and weight of milk volumes per deposit
Liaise with Lactation Consultation and fellow diet techs daily
Communicate with donors on a daily basis to schedule shipping of their donations
Answering Milk bank phone lines and redirecting calls to LC's , Director or Supervisor if required
Retrieving phone message on a daily basis
Creating LIS labels for culture samples
Prepare milk to be pasteurized using aseptic techniques
Disinfect and Sanitize pasteurizers and counters daily. Sanitization of beakers and other equipment after pasteurization in dishwasher
Daily Documentation of fridges and freezer temperatures
Accurately weigh and receive incoming milk
Communicate with lactation consultants, co-workers, and moms to ensure accurate milk preparation, collection and storage
Answer Milk Bank phone line, retrieve phone messages and return calls or re-direct to Lactation Consultants as required
LIS label for pool and batch cultures. Print Post pasteurization (batch) bottle labels
Collect culture samples from pool into labeled test tube and cryovial using appropriate technique
Label culture tubes and place in specimen bags, take to fridge and both cryovial to freezer and place in pool pre-culture bin in designated bag of the month
Using Timeless software - generate batch labels for post pasteurization milk and move milk from freezer to fridge
Document number of bottles pasteurized onto batch sheet
Take all culture samples to the lab on the 14 floor by 16:30 hours
Create online pick-up/delivery orders
Send milk collection kits to donors via courier services
Package and dispense human donor milk using Timeless Milk Tracking System software to hospitals in Ontario as per received orders
Report any unsafe situation to the Milk Bank
Job Requirements
Food and Nutrition Degree/Diploma from a recognized university or community college
Food Safety Training Certificate
Recent Diet Technician experience in a healthcare environment
Knowledge of safe food handling procedures
Canadian Society of Nutrition Management membership an asset
Good communication and interpersonal skills. Ability to liaise with health professionals and patient families
Excellent oral and written communication skills, excellent problem solving and time management skills
Demonstrated attention to detail with a high level of accuracy
Proven leadership skills
Advanced computer skills and familiarity with Timeless software
Proven organizational and time management skills
Capable to work under pressure and meet time deadlines as part of a team or independently
Ability to stand for long periods of time doing repetitive action, bend, push and lift up to 20 pounds
Demonstrated satisfactory work performance and attendance history
